CITY COUNCIL ACTION REPORT
SUBJECT:
APPROVAL OF NEW SERIES 12 (RESTAURANT) LIQUOR LICENSE FOR POPO'S FIESTA DEL SOL

SUMMARY
The applicant is requesting a recommendation of approval for a New Series 12 (Restaurant) liquor license.

FISCAL IMPACT
The applicant paid the $635 application fee for the liquor license per the Goodyear Municipal User Fee Schedule. The business will also contribute to the tax base of the community.
BACKGROUND AND PREVIOUS ACTIONS
A new Series 12 liquor license application was submitted by Ms. Morse on behalf of Popo's Fiesta Del Sol. The establishment is scheduled to open in April 2024 under an interim permit that was issued by the Arizona Department of Liquor Licenses and Control (DLLC). A license applicant is granted an interim permit, which is a provisional authorization issued pursuant to A.R.S §4-203.01. This authorization permits the sale of spirituous liquor to continue while the application is pending. Existing licenses must be of the same series and location as the pending application, with a maximum validity period of 105 days, to qualify.
The City Clerk's office received the application from the DLLC on March 27, 2024, and the Public Hearing notice was posted on April 3rd, 2024 to comply with Arizona Revised Statutes §4-201(b). No petitions or protests from qualified persons were received during the comment period. The application was routed to the Police Department and the Development Services Department (Code Compliance and Planning & Zoning), and the departments had no comments.
STAFF ANALYSIS
A Series 12 liquor license is for a restaurant and is non-transferrable. This on-sale retail privileges liquor license allows the holder to sell all types of spirituous liquor solely for consumption on the premises of an establishment that derives at least forty percent (40%) of its gross revenue from the sale of food.
DLLC requires liquor license owners, agents, and managers actively involved in the day-to-day operations of the business to complete a state-approved management training course prior to the issuance of a liquor license. The two owners and managers have taken the Title 4 Basic & Management training.
Managers and staff will require a valid ID to purchase alcohol if the guest appears to be under the legal drinking age and watch to make sure of age customers do not provide to underage.
There are no licensed childcare facilities or K-12 schools within 300 feet of the location to comply with Arizona Revised Statutes §4-207. City Council's recommendation of "Approval", "Disapproval" or "No Recommendation" will be forwarded to the DLLC for consideration during their licensing review process.
